Safety and Rules

4.
Safety and Rules


Main rules for electric mobility


Basic rules for those with and without


Basic rules for those with and without

  • In principle, you must drive on the left side of the road. You must not drive on the right side (the wrong way around).
  • Two-seater riding is prohibited.
    (Only for specified small mopeds, special specified small mopeds, and mopeds of the first class. Mobility levels above this vary depending on the vehicle.)
  • Driving under the influence of alcohol is prohibited by law.
  • You need to get a license plate.
  • Riding on the sidewalk is prohibited in principle.
  • Pedestrians have the right of way at crosswalks, and bicycles have the right of way at bicycle crossings. The same applies to intersections without crosswalks.
License- free
electric mobility

Specific small motorized bicycles such as electric kick scooters

  • If you are 16 years of age or older, you can drive without a license.
  • Wearing a helmet is mandatory
    (we recommend wearing a helmet just in case)

Electric mobility requiring a license

Electric motorcycles and other motorized bicycles

  • A driver's license is required.
  • Wearing a helmet is required by law.

Safe driving tips

Safe driving tips

  • Always pay attention to the traffic conditions around you.
  • Maintain an appropriate distance from pedestrians and other vehicles.
  • Avoid sudden lane changes and remember to use your turn signals.
  • Always obey road signs and traffic lights.
  • Drive carefully, especially in bad weather.
  • When riding at night, it is recommended to turn on the lights and use reflective materials.
  • To prepare for accidents, compulsory automobile liability insurance is required, and voluntary automobile liability insurance is recommended.

Prohibitions

Prohibitions

  • Driving while using a mobile phone, etc.
  • Driving while using earphones, etc.
  • Driving above the speed limit
  • Drunk driving
  • *This content is based on relevant laws and regulations such as the Road Traffic Act.
  • *Detailed rules may vary depending on the region.
  • *The content may change due to changes in the law.
